Get Started With Career and College Promise

New Students

Step 1: Contact your high school representative (Counselor, Distance Learning Advisor, Career Development Coordinator or Homeschool Administrator) for information on eligibility and enrollment.

Step 2: Complete the Career and College Promise Application. After doing so, you will receive a welcome letter with information on how to set up your login for Moodle, email, and Patriot Port.

Step 3: Complete and submit the forms listed below:

  1. Permission Form
  2. Liability Form

Step 4: Submit a high school transcript which must meet the following criteria:

  • student grade level (9th, 10th, 11th and/or 12th grade) with academic year assigned and
  • high school courses completed and in progress and
  • unweighted, cumulative high school GPA (UGPA) and
  • expected graduation date

Additional high school transcripts must be provided to the college to verify the student is still enrolled in high school and making progress towards high school graduation for each term they are enrolled in CCP.

Step 5: Register for classes during designated time frames specified in the Academic Calendar. For additional information, please email ccp@isothermal.edu.

Step 6: Verify class(es) through the ICC Patriot Port account.

Step 7: Attend class and begin coursework.

Returning Students

To maintain eligibility for continued enrollment, a student must

  • Continue to make progress toward high school graduation, and
  • Maintain a 2.0 GPA in college coursework after completing two courses.
  • A student who falls below a 2.0 GPA after completing two college courses will be subject to the college’s policy for satisfactory academic progress.

Registration process if eligible for continued enrollment:

  1. Meet with your high school counselor (or designee) to discuss dual enrollment options
    • Homeschool students will meet with their homeschool administrator and setup an appointment with the homeschool coordinator. This meeting can be arranged by emailing ccp@isothermal.edu
  2. Meet with the ICC representative at your high schools designated time. Check with your high school for schedule availability. Home school students will schedule appointments with the homeschool coordinator by emailing ccp@isothermal.edu
  3. Registration will occur on the designated CCP registration day(s)
  4. Verify classes through the student's ICC Patriot Port account
  5. Attend class

High School Transcripts

State Board Code requires the submission of a high school transcript verifying student eligibility for a Career and College Promise College Transfer pathway and/or Career and Technical Education pathway. High school transcripts must include the following:
  • student grade level (9th, 10th, 11th and/or 12th grade) and
  • high school courses completed and in progress and
  • unweighted, cumulative high school GPA
